## 1.14.0 — Linter defaults tightened

This release changes Proseguard's default ruleset. Previously, broken internal links and missing alt text were warnings; both are now errors, since downgrading them let regressions slip into the Fennel Docs portal unnoticed. The heading-depth rule remains a warning, but the maximum depth drops from six to four. Reviewers should note that CI will fail on any doc touched in a PR, not just new files. Teams needing a grace period can pin the previous ruleset. The new effective defaults are listed below.

config for kafof-bawef:
holath:
  log_level: debug
  metrics_host: metrics.holath.qorvelsys.internal
  pin: 2191
  pool_size: 32

## Who to ping about GiftNote

Welcome aboard! GiftNote is our donation-receipt mailer for the Larchfield Fund. Template tweaks go to the comms folks; delivery failures and bounce weirdness go to the platform crew. Don't push template changes on Fridays — receipts batch over the weekend. For anything GiftNote-related, start with the address below.

billing contact of kaweg-tajeg = drudor.lamion.oliath@torvalabs.test

## Deployment

Splitgate, our A/B assignment service, ships as a single container behind the Varnholt edge proxy. No inbound ports besides 8443. Secrets come from the Quillvault sidecar at boot; nothing is baked into the image. Rollouts are blue-green, gated by the Ferrow pipeline. Review the following runtime configuration before approving the release.

service settings:
[casax]
port = 6379
team = rusir
host = casax.zemvarhq.corp
region = outer-4
access_code = ac_9808ce
timeout_ms = 1500

Briefing — Leadership Review: Logistics Provider Change

For finance: we are exiting the Mervale Logistics contract and appointing Stornbridge Freight from Q2. Termination fee is within budgeted contingency. Stornbridge rates run 7% lower on trunk routes; last-mile is flat. Working-capital impact minimal; invoicing moves to 45-day terms. Reconcile Mervale accruals before cutover. The note below is restricted to this group.

management briefing: The pricing group signed off on a budget of $378.8 million for Project Kasael.